Hormonal Harmony

Menopause is a natural transition in a woman's life defined by the gradual decline of estrogen and progesterone levels. This change can lead a variety of physical and emotional symptoms, often causing struggles.

Quite a few women experience flushes, sleep disturbances, and mood swings. It's important to remember that you are not alone in this journey. There are many strategies available to help you navigate menopause and achieve hormonal harmony.

One step is to talk to your doctor about your symptoms and concerns. They can provide personalized advice based on your individual needs.

In addition to medical guidance, try out lifestyle changes that may help ease menopause symptoms.These include:

* Participating in exercise

* Consuming a nutritious diet that includes fruits, vegetables, and whole grains

* Practicing techniques to cope with yoga, meditation, or deep breathing exercises

* Aiming for 7-8 hours of quality sleep each night

By taking a proactive approach to your health and well-being, you can find hormonal harmony during this transformative phase of life.
